In Loving Memory of Mrs. Pamela Kay Fielder Stafford

"Pam earned a bachelor’s degree in elementary education and a master’s degree in music education from the University of Mississippi and remained a great supporter and fan of the Ole Miss Rebels. She taught music at South Panola School District for 35 years. Being a “master” of piano, guitar, and voice, she shared her gift with many students, including her creation of choral camps and coordination of the annual musical “American Pop”."

In Loving Memory of Mrs. Marilyn "Jean" King

"Jean was a devoted Christian and member of Peace Lutheran Church, where she served as treasurer, Sunday school teacher, and volunteer for many church ministries. Deeply committed to her community, she was an active advocate for the Oxford Food Pantry, often organizing volunteer schedules, managing service days, and helping families in need. She also served as a Girl Scout Troop 98 leader, frequently seen at the local Kroger selling cookies with her troop. Jean supported Al-Anon and Alcoholics Anonymous groups in Oxford, offering encouragement and guidance to others."
